Algeria, with its rich cultural heritage and traditions, is a country where Children's games hold a special place in the hearts of both young and old. Among the many popular games enjoyed by Algerian children, the egg-related ones have a unique charm and significance. Let's delve into the delightful world of traditional Algerian children's games involving eggs. 1. **Egg Rolling**: One of the most beloved egg-related games in Algeria is egg rolling. This game is usually played during Easter celebrations or other festive occasions. Children decorate boiled eggs with colorful dyes or paints before rolling them down a hill or slope. The egg that rolls the farthest without cracking is declared the winner, adding an element of excitement and friendly competition to the game. 2. **Egg Toss**: Another classic egg game enjoyed by Algerian children is egg toss. In this game, participants form pairs and stand facing each other at a certain distance apart. They take turns tossing a raw egg to their partner, who must catch it without breaking it. The pair that successfully catches the egg without it cracking wins the game. Egg toss fosters teamwork and coordination among children while providing plenty of laughter and entertainment. 3. **Egg and Spoon Race**: The egg and spoon race is a timeless favorite among Algerian children. Participants balance a raw egg on a spoon held in their mouths or hands while racing to the finish line. The challenge lies in maintaining balance and stability to prevent the egg from falling off the spoon. This game not only promotes concentration and motor skills but also adds an element of suspense and thrill to the competition. 4. **Egg Juggling**: For children with nimble fingers and a love for challenges, egg juggling is a mesmerizing game that showcases their dexterity and agility. In this game, participants attempt to juggle and flip an egg without dropping or breaking it. The rhythmic movement and precision required to successfully juggle the egg make it a captivating and skill-testing game for children of all ages.
